Summary/Abstract: This paper focuses on the creation of the town of Tatar Bazari (Pazardzhik) at the turn of the 14th century. Revisiting the existing theories, which discuss the founders and the establishment of the town, the author argues that the claims of Tatar Bazari’s creation in 1480s or 1410s cannot be confirmed by the sources and should be regarded as groundless. Based on Ottoman archival sources and Byzantine and Ottoman narratives the article puts forward a new suggestion according to which the town was established around 1398 by a group of Crimean Tatars.
